The saying, 'Vitamin E Zinc Acne' refers to the role of
vitamin E and Zinc in the treatment or prevention of acne. These two
are very beneficial in the prevention of acne. One thing to know about
vitamin E is that, its deficiency does not cause any disease in the
body, and its presence helps in maintaining healthy skin by eliminating
the harmful free radicals, generated during cellular metabolism. It also
helps in skin recovery from acne scarring. It reduces the appearance of
scars due to Acne, as well. Retinol levels in the body are regulated by
vitamin E, which is essential for healthy skin, mucous membrane and
proper vision.
Vitamin E is related to vitamin
A, as deficiency of vitamin E would lead to low levels of vitamin A in
your body, as well. Also, vitamin E is essential for its interactions
with Selenium, which is an important antioxidant trace mineral. So, acne
can be diminished by the proper supplementation of vitamin E and
Selenium in your diet.
Zinc is equally an essential nutrient for
the healthy skin. Zinc is essential for the proper metabolism of
Testosterone, as low levels of Zinc increase the conversion to DTH from
Testosterone, which stimulates the production of Sebum and Keratin.
These in turn are the primary factors for causing acne. Some forms of
Zinc like effervescent Zinc and Zinc gluconate are very effective. Zinc
is essential for the absorption of vitamin A and it also regulates the
level of vitamin E in the blood. It also boosts the immune system and
helps in killing the acne bacteria.
Zinc synthesizes proteins and
protects the body from free radicals, also triggers the birth of new
white blood cells. Food sources of Zinc include poultry, dairy, wheat
germ, liver, whole grains, sea food, sunflower seeds and many more.
